View Javadoc

1   package ecar.pojo;
2   
3   // Generated Aug 13, 2009 2:24:15 PM by Hibernate Tools 3.2.0.CR1
4   
5   import java.util.HashSet;
6   import java.util.Set;
7   import javax.persistence.Column;
8   import javax.persistence.Entity;
9   import javax.persistence.FetchType;
10  import javax.persistence.GeneratedValue;
11  import javax.persistence.Id;
12  import javax.persistence.OneToMany;
13  import javax.persistence.Table;
14  import org.hibernate.annotations.GenericGenerator;
15  
16  /**
17   * StatusRelatorioSrl generated by hbm2java
18   */
19  @Entity
20  @Table(name = "TB_STATUS_RELATORIO_SRL")
21  public class StatusRelatorioSrl implements java.io.Serializable {
22  
23    private Long codSrl;
24    private String indAtivoSrl;
25    private String descricaoSrl;
26    private Set<AcompReferenciaItemAri> acompReferenciaItemAris = new HashSet<AcompReferenciaItemAri>(0);
27  
28    public StatusRelatorioSrl() {
29    }
30  
31    public StatusRelatorioSrl(String indAtivoSrl, String descricaoSrl, Set<AcompReferenciaItemAri> acompReferenciaItemAris) {
32      this.indAtivoSrl = indAtivoSrl;
33      this.descricaoSrl = descricaoSrl;
34      this.acompReferenciaItemAris = acompReferenciaItemAris;
35    }
36  
37    @GenericGenerator(name = "generator", strategy = "increment")
38    @Id
39    @GeneratedValue(generator = "generator")
40    @Column(name = "COD_SRL", nullable = false)
41    public Long getCodSrl() {
42      return this.codSrl;
43    }
44  
45    public void setCodSrl(Long codSrl) {
46      this.codSrl = codSrl;
47    }
48  
49    @Column(name = "IND_ATIVO_SRL", length = 1)
50    public String getIndAtivoSrl() {
51      return this.indAtivoSrl;
52    }
53  
54    public void setIndAtivoSrl(String indAtivoSrl) {
55      this.indAtivoSrl = indAtivoSrl;
56    }
57  
58    @Column(name = "DESCRICAO_SRL", length = 20)
59    public String getDescricaoSrl() {
60      return this.descricaoSrl;
61    }
62  
63    public void setDescricaoSrl(String descricaoSrl) {
64      this.descricaoSrl = descricaoSrl;
65    }
66  
67    @OneToMany(fetch = FetchType.LAZY, mappedBy = "statusRelatorioSrl")
68    public Set<AcompReferenciaItemAri> getAcompReferenciaItemAris() {
69      return this.acompReferenciaItemAris;
70    }
71  
72    public void setAcompReferenciaItemAris(Set<AcompReferenciaItemAri> acompReferenciaItemAris) {
73      this.acompReferenciaItemAris = acompReferenciaItemAris;
74    }
75  
76  }